Well, the Hijri date 16 Jumada Al Akhira 1421 corresponds to the Gregorian date Thursday, 14 September 2000. This date lies in the sixth month of the Hijri year 1421 AH, which is Jumada Al-Thani of 1421 AH. Both this Hijri and Gregorian date occur on the single day that is Thursday without any doubt. The Arabic date 1421/06/16 is calculated using the Umm Al-Qura calendar and the sighting of the moon. One thing to remember is that this Arabic date may occur on different Gregorian date depending upon the region and country and obviously the moon.

Sahih al-Bukhari
Gifts
Chapter: Giving presents to Al-Mushrikun
Narrated Asma' bint Abu Bakr:
My mother came to me during the lifetime of Allah's Messenger (ﷺ) and she was a pagan. I said to Allah's Apostle (seeking his verdict), "My mother has come to me and she desires to receive a reward from me, shall I keep good relations with her?" The Prophet (ﷺ) said, "Yes, keep good relation with her. "
Sahih al-Bukhari 2620
